> We have some tests the only pass when run through gradle (as opposed to 
> running via the Intellij test runner).  If one of these tests fails in CI, it 
> is easy to being debugging them in the IDE without realizing that they will 
> *never* pass when not run via gradle.  Until we fix the underlying issues 
> that require running through gradle, it would be nice for such tests to 
> detect when they are running outside of gradle, and to notify the user that 
> they should be expected to fail.
